Output d089363f8ff76f22b3e9af69d10e204ac395b6d20252e90360b974fa282dd35e:0

value
809662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2106a11faf1020eb3a06d4b31cc990aaac491c95 OP_EQUAL
address
34heAVW7aHcUhpLEwpq7CCj4ahzHyVYBq7
transaction
d089363f8ff76f22b3e9af69d10e204ac395b6d20252e90360b974fa282dd35e